Companies Act 2014

Applicable laws during transition period

58. (1) During the period beginning on the commencement of this Part and ending on the expiry of the transition period, Part 16 shall, subject to subsection (3) and without prejudice to subsection (7), apply to an existing private company as if it were a designated activity company, unless and until there is delivered to the Registrar, in accordance with this Chapter, a constitution in respect of it in the form provided under section 19 .

(2) If there is so delivered to the Registrar such a constitution in respect of that company then, on and from such delivery, this Part and Parts 1 and 3 to 15 shall apply to that company.

(3) The provisions of the prior Companies Acts relating to the use of limited or teoranta (or their abbreviations) shall apply as respects the name of an existing private company referred to in subsection (1) during the period referred to in that subsection and not the provisions of section 969 and the other relevant provisions of Part 16 .

(4) The reference in subsection (3) to provisions relating to the use of any words includes a reference to provisions conferring an exemption from the use of those words.

(5) An existing private company that has adopted, or is deemed to have adopted, in whole or in part, the regulations of Table A as its articles, shall, despite the repeal of the Act of 1963, continue to be governed by those regulations (or the parts of them concerned) after the repeal of that Act and, without prejudice to subsection (8), before the expiry of the transition period unless and until—

(a) there is delivered to the Registrar, in accordance with this Chapter, a constitution in respect of it in the form provided under section 19 ; or

(b) it re-registers as another type of company,

but, as regards the company continuing to be governed by the foregoing regulations—

(i) this is save to the extent that those regulations are inconsistent with a mandatory provision;

(ii) those regulations may be altered or added to under and in accordance with the conditions under which articles, whenever registered, are permitted by Part 16 to be altered or added to; and

(iii) references in those regulations to any provision of the prior Companies Acts shall be read as references to the corresponding provision of this Act.

(6) Subject to paragraphs (ii) and (iii) of that subsection, the regulations referred to in subsection (5) shall be interpreted according to the form in which they existed on the date of repeal of the Act of 1963.

(7) To take account of any interregnum between—

(a) the delivery (in accordance with this Chapter and in the form provided under section 19 ) of a constitution in respect of an existing private company to the Registrar for registration; and

(b) its registration by the Registrar,

it is declared that subsections (1) and (2) operate, and are to be read as operating, so as also to provide that Part 16 applies, subject to subsection (3), to that company as if it were a designated activity company during any such interregnum (and accordingly that the application of this Part, and Parts 1 and 3 to 15 , to it is postponed until that registration is effected).

(8) Likewise, to take account of any similar interregnum in the case of subsection (5), it is declared that that subsection operates, and is to be read as operating, so as also to provide that the whole or part (as the case may be) of the regulations of Table A continue to govern the company concerned during any such interregnum.

(9) For the avoidance of doubt, the application of Part 16 , in the circumstances under this section where that Part is stated to apply and notwithstanding that the course of action of delivering a constitution of the kind referred to in subsection (1) will not be adopted by such a company, extends to an existing private company falling within subsection (10) but—

(a) the application of Part 16 to such a company does not affect the application of the provisions of the statute referred to in subsection (10) (or any other relevant statute) to the company; and

(b) if, by virtue of the foregoing statute, the company was not required to include the word “limited” or “teoranta” in its name, that exemption is not affected by anything in this section or Part 16 .

(10) The existing private company referred to in subsection (9) is one that has been incorporated under a former enactment relating to companies (within the meaning of section 5 ) pursuant to, or in compliance with a requirement of, any statute.
